Adopted Section 106 and CIL SPD

Our Section 106 and CIL SPD (PDF, 3.1mb), which was adopted in 2015 and amended in November 2020, sets out the council’s approach to both Section 106 legal agreements and the Community Infrastructure Levy (CIL). Both of these are tools to secure investment in the borough and around development sites which is designed to offset any impact that a development will have.

We adopted an addendum to the SPD (PDF, 505kb) in January 2017 which sets out our approach to Section 106 and CIL in the Old Kent Road Opportunity Area. You can find out more information about the addendum and view the supporting documents below.

Southwark Council declared a Climate Emergency in March 2019. After this, we adopted another addendum to the SPD (PDF, 3.1mb) which updates the cost of carbon we secure for carbon offsetting financial contributions. These contributions are added to our Carbon Offset Fund. You can find more information about November 2020 Addendum and the supporting documents below.
